Moray eels are fascinating creatures often seen by divers. They have long, snake-like bodies and can be quite colorful. Morays use their unique jaws for capturing prey, like fish and crustaceans. They help keep ocean ecosystems healthy but can be misunderstood as aggressive. Divers should be careful and respectful when swimming near them.
